# Break-Glass: Payroll Export Format Change

Scope: Wrenfold payroll pipeline. The export moved from v2 fixed-width to v3 delimited. Reviewers: reject any PR touching the serializer without a golden-file diff. Legacy v2 generation is frozen; the signing key for v2 artifacts sits in the break-glass locker and should only be pulled for regulator-requested reruns. Log every access in the change journal. The locker opens with the recovery passphrase below.

unlock words, bawip-taduf: casix-belael-norael-silwyn

Handover: Stormline alert fan-out.

The fan-out service takes inbound weather bulletins from the Cloudmere feed and dispatches them to registered plugin endpoints in parallel batches of 50, with exponential backoff on failures. Plugin authors should note the new delivery-receipt header is mandatory as of v3; unacknowledged alerts retry for 15 minutes, then dead-letter. Schema docs live in the fanout/contracts directory. I'm moving to the ingestion team, so future plugin compatibility questions go to the maintainer named below.

named custodian: Brivan Eliath Quenox Frador

TICKET GRID-482: Config drift on Puzzlewright crossword generator. Staging and prod diverged after last month's manual hotfix — grid sizes and dictionary paths no longer match. New contractor: don't hand-edit prod. Reconcile against the canonical file in the Puzzlewright repo, redeploy, then verify clue generation on both environments. The expected production values are listed below.

settings of fafog-haduf:
ZORIX_PIN=4648
ZORIX_METRICS_HOST=metrics.zorix.paliqsys.corp
ZORIX_LOG_LEVEL=info
ZORIX_TENANT=druix

Environments — Quillgate SFTP drop

Quillgate receives partner files via a dedicated SFTP drop per environment. Staging uses a throwaway bucket purged nightly; production retains files for thirty days. Pickup jobs poll every five minutes and reject unsigned payloads. Reviewers: changes to polling or retention must update both environments in one PR. Current production values follow.

service settings:
PRAIX_LOG_LEVEL=error
PRAIX_METRICS_HOST=metrics.praix.qorvelcorp.corp
PRAIX_POOL_SIZE=16